Management Commentary
During the recent earnings call for the third quarter of 2025, Aterian’s management acknowledged the reported GAAP loss per share of -$0.28, noting that the quarter reflected ongoing investments in platform optimization and brand rationalization. The leadership team highlighted progress in streamlining the company’s product portfolio, with a sharper focus on higher-margin, repeat-purchase categories. Operational highlights included the continued scaling of automated marketing tools and supply chain efficiencies, which management indicated could support improved unit economics over time. The discussion also touched on the divestiture of several underperforming brands, a move aimed at strengthening the balance sheet and concentrating resources on core growth areas. While top-line revenue figures were not disclosed, management pointed to a sequential improvement in gross margin trajectory and a reduction in operating expenses as evidence of the restructuring strategy taking hold. Looking ahead, executives emphasized a disciplined approach to capital allocation and expressed confidence in the company’s ability to navigate near-term market volatility, though they cautioned that the full benefits of the restructuring may take additional quarters to materialize.

Forward Guidance
Aterian management acknowledged near-term headwinds but underscored a continued focus on operational efficiency and cost discipline heading into the next fiscal year. In its recently released Q3 2025 earnings commentary, the company highlighted ongoing investments in its proprietary Avalon platform and data-driven marketing capabilities, which management expects may gradually improve unit economics. While no specific revenue or EBITDA guidance was provided for the upcoming quarters, executives noted that efforts to streamline inventory and reduce fixed costs could support a path toward positive adjusted EBITDA over time. The company also signaled cautious optimism regarding potential growth in its home and kitchen verticals, though it tempered expectations due to macroeconomic uncertainty and shifting consumer demand patterns. Management reiterated a focus on cash preservation and margin expansion, suggesting that near-term revenue growth may remain subdued as the company prioritizes profitability. Any forward trajectory will likely depend on the effectiveness of recent restructuring initiatives and the timing of broader retail recovery. Market Reaction
The market response to Aterian’s recently released Q3 2025 results has been cautious, with shares experiencing modest pressure in the days following the announcement. The reported EPS of -$0.28, while within a range some analysts had anticipated, highlighted ongoing challenges in the company’s path to profitability. Trading volume during the initial reaction period was slightly elevated compared to recent averages, suggesting active repositioning by investors.
Several analysts have noted that the absence of revenue figures may have amplified uncertainty regarding top-line trends, potentially weighing on near-term sentiment. Some observers pointed to the company’s cost-control measures as a stabilizing factor, but the lack of top-line visibility could keep the stock range-bound until more concrete operational updates emerge. The stock’s price movement since the release suggests that market participants are adopting a “wait and see” approach, with the broader macro environment also influencing risk appetite for smaller-cap names.
Overall, the reaction underscores a market that is closely watching for tangible progress toward cash-flow generation. Without a clearer revenue trajectory, the stock may continue to face headwinds, though any future announcements regarding new partnerships or product milestones could provide catalysts for a shift in sentiment.
